Default RKE issues.

2009 Qc Laramie;111k Hey fellas, this all started after TIPM failure;So the dealer replaces the Tipm and I go to get in it, doors do not open, only with the key, and then the alarm goes off until the fob is inserted; dealer says its a defective tipm, they change it again, same thing, check all fobs,[2 are brand new] all fobs are good. They change the PCM, and the win module, same issue. Upon disconnecting the battery it will work fine for a few hours and then nothing.Then out of the blue it will work fine, then nothing. Its a factory remote start as well, any ideas? Can this system be bypassed? and replaced by aftermarket?Thank You.
